Why bundle and promotion planning matters on the Marvos 4
Device plus consumable bundles protect margin better than a straight discount.
In practice the decision comes down to three numbers: unit cost, freight per unit and the realistic sell through rate for Marvos 4.
Limiting a promotion to a defined period keeps urgency without permanent price erosion.

Checklist
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.

Frequently asked questions
What bundle works best for Marvos 4?
Device plus a starter pack of consumables, priced to look like a saving while holding hardware margin.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
